What does a Traffic Control Officer do?

Transport and distribution clerks and assistants perform various clerical functions relating to the transport and distribution of goods and freight.

Tasks required include:

  • Processes customer orders and forwards requisition documentation to storage and distribution personnel.
  • Formulates delivery loads, vehicle schedules and routes to be followed by delivery staff.
  • Monitors tachograph readings and maintains records of hours worked and distance travelled by drivers.
  • Obtains customs clearance and processes import and export documentation necessary for the movement of goods between countries.
  • Maintains records regarding the movement and location of freight, containers and staff.
What are the entry requirements for a Traffic Control Officer?

There are no minimum academic requirements, although entrants usually possess GCSEs/S grades. Training is usually provided on-the-job. NVQs/ SVQs in relevant areas are available at Levels 1, 2 and 3.
